导语:TP钱包不仅是一个私钥与资产管理工具,更是链接去中心化金融、节点治理与用户体验的生态枢纽。本文从防代码注入、合约调试、资产统计、高可用性、DPoS挖矿与数字金融革命六个维度,系统性探讨TP钱包生态构建的实践与策略。
一、防代码注入(安全层面)
TP钱包面临的主要威胁之一是代码注入(包括前端脚本注入、恶意合约交互与签名钓鱼)。防护策略应当多层展开:输入与输出严格白名单化;对外部资源(dApp、插件)采用权限沙箱与最小化授权;交易签名界面增加可验证原文与参数解析,避免用户盲签;引入静态与动态分析工具扫描第三方合约ABI与字节码,自动标注风险函数(如delegatecall、selfdestruct);整合多方签名与硬件钱包支持,降低单点失误带来的损失。此外,持续的漏洞赏金计划与自动化渗透测试是生态长期健康的保障。
二、合约调试(开发与运维)

合约调试应覆盖本地模拟、联邦测试与线上回溯。TP钱包可提供开发者工具链:内置私有测试网络(fork主网快照)用于交易回放、模拟器支持EVM trace与调用栈展示、gas分析与异常断点;对已部署合约提供可视化ABI解析、事件流与状态快照对比,便于定位逻辑错误与重入风险。集成形式化验证与符号执行(针对核心合约模块)可在发布前发现潜在漏洞。调试同时要考虑隐私与可审计性,敏感数据脱敏记录、操作日志链上或链下双重存证以便事后溯源。
三、资产统计(用户与链上视角)

资产统计不只是余额展示,更是资产画像与风险洞察。TP钱包应实现统一资产目录(跨链资产映射)、实时余额聚合、历史净值曲线与盈亏分析。链上索引器结合事件解析,支持持仓分布、流动性挖矿收益、未实现收益与交易成本统计。面向机构可提供API与批量导出(含税务报告格式),并加入异常行为检测(如瞬时大额迁移、频繁授权改变),提醒用户潜在被盗或合约风险。隐私保护方面,可提供可选的本地计算或差分隐私聚合,既满足统计需求又不泄露个人细节。
四、高可用性(系统与节点架构)
TP钱包作为用户入口,对可用性与延迟敏感。高可用设计包含多活架构、负载均衡、自动故障转移与细粒度熔断策略。RPC与索引服务应做到读写分离、多地域部署、缓存与本地化加速(例如对常用代币价格与余额做边缘缓存);对关键服务(签名服务、交易池)采用多副本冗余与心跳检测,确保单点故障不会中断用户操作。备份策略需覆盖密钥管理与交易记录,结合演练计划(故障切换、数据恢复)降低灾难恢复时间。监控与报警体系要覆盖业务指标(交易成功率、签名延迟)与安全指标(异常登录、授权异常)。
五、DPoS挖矿(治理与激励)
DPoS(Delegated Proof of Stake)在许多公链中用于高吞吐与社区治理。TP钱包在生态中可承担节点展示、委托流程与收益分配的用户界面与路由逻辑。关键点包括:透明的验证者信息(出块率、在线率、惩罚记录、收益率)、委托与赎回延迟的明确提示、收益自动复投或分配策略的可配置性;支持分片委托、按权益加权的收益计算与验证者更换流程。为防止中心化倾向,钱包应在界面设计上鼓励分散委托(如展示小众高质量候选者)并支持投票与治理提案的安全签名与连署。DPoS机制还需要与高可用性结合:验证者节点的监控、快速切换与黑名单机制,保障委托资产不因节点离线或作恶而损失。
六、数字金融革命(钱包的角色与未来)
TP钱包正处于数字金融基础设施的核心位置:它既是身份与权限管理器,也是链上金融服务的聚合层。随着可组合金融(Composability)、跨链桥与隐私计算成熟,钱包将从“看护资产”转变为“编排金融”的终端——自动化策略、条件支付、合成资产、社会化保险与链上信用评分都会成为标配。要实现这一愿景,基础设施需先确保安全(防注入与审计)、可观测(资产统计与合约调试)与高可用(多级冗余、跨链路由)。同时,治理与激励层(如DPoS)将决定生态去中心化与激励公平性。
结语:构建可持续的TP钱包生态,需要在工程实现与治理设计上同时发力。技术层面强调防注入、可调试与高可用,数据层面聚焦准确与可审计的资产统计,治理层面依赖透明与激励兼顾的DPoS机制。只有把安全、可用与用户价值紧密结合,钱包才能在数字金融革命中成为可信、可扩展的桥梁。
评论
小云
文章把技术与治理结合得很清晰,尤其是对DPoS和高可用性的实践建议很实用。
Alex_Wallet
关于防代码注入的具体实现能否再举几个开源工具和流程示例?期待后续深度文章。
链上观察者
资产统计部分很有洞察力,差分隐私的提法很值得推广,保护用户隐私同时满足统计需求很关键。
Maya2025
合约调试那一节对开发者友好,尤其是本地fork和trace展示,能帮很多人定位复杂BUG。